What makes Ft Worth pipes unique
Homes here are a mix of eras and dirts. If you reside in Fairmount or Mistletoe Levels, original actors iron and galvanized lines still snake with some walls and crawlspaces. Newer builds in Partnership and far west usage PVC and PEX with much fewer legacy frustrations, however the dirt does not care about your closing date. North Texas clay expands when it is wet and contracts when it is completely dry. Over a years of periods, that movement tensions foundations and shifts lines. Slab leakages are not unusual, they belong to the landscape. A skilled plumber in Fort Worth recognizes to look for foundation activity prior to gluing a fast repair to a reoccuring problem.
Weather shapes our emergency situations. That February freeze in 2021 taught the whole city just how copper in uninsulated exterior walls reacts to single number evenings. Summertime is a various monster, with irrigation systems and water heaters burning the midnight oil. Storms roll in hard, gutters overflow, and origins hunt for every decrease in clay. Sewage system backups spike during or after hefty rainfalls. A local plumber in Ft Worth has lived these cycles and sets vans up appropriately, heat tape and insulation in wintertime, jetters and electronic camera rigs all set when the ground is wet.
Permits and code issue, also when water is an inch deep. The Texas State Board of Plumbing Examiners licenses plumbers, and the City of Ft Worth expects permits on details work such as hot water heater replacement, re-pipes, and gas line adjustments. A qualified plumber in Ft Worth will walk you through what is urgent tonight and what calls for an authorization tomorrow. Great contractors do not hide behind emergency situations to avoid paperwork. They series the job so your home is safe now and compliant later.
What is immediate and what can wait a few hours
A real emergency is a circumstance that risks instant damages, safety, or loss of important solution. A burst supply line, commode overruning into a downstairs ceiling, gas smell near a heater closet, a sewer backup that will certainly not stop, or a hot water heater that is proactively dripping, those are emergencies. A slow drip under a sink with a container catching it, possibly not. The distinction is not academic. Emergency situation prices run greater permanently reasons, overtime labor and dispatch prices. A Pipes Company Fort Worth locals can rely on will inform you simply when a damp towel and a shutoff valve can buy a few hours until typical rates kick in.
Here is a general rule from years in the field. If water is moving fast and you can not stop it by shutting a nearby valve, or if you scent gas, you are in emergency territory. If you can quit the problem with a regional shutoff or the main, and the area is secure and dry, you can likely set up for the early morning. That judgment saves you cash without gambling with your home.
First steps prior to the plumber arrives
Those first minutes determine just how much damage spreads. Every homeowner and residential or commercial property manager should recognize the area of the main shutoff, the water heater shutoff, and the gas meter valve. If you do not, stroll the building in daylight and find them. Label them. You do not wish to discover throughout a 3 a.m. Shuffle with water lapping at your ankles.
- Kill the water at the resource, begin with a neighborhood valve under a sink or bathroom, after that make use of the major shutoff at the curb or where the line goes into your home if needed. For gas odors, leave, do not make use of electric switches, call the gas business emergency line, then your plumber. Shut off the water heater's chilly supply if it is leaking, and switch over the heating unit control to off, gas or electric. Protect what you can, relocate rugs, electronic devices, and furnishings, and start wiping or damp vacuuming to keep water out of walls. Take quick photos and short videos, specifically if you want to submit insurance later.
These actions do not repair anything. They stop the clock on additional damages, which is commonly the distinction between a problem and a remodel.

Reading quotes without needing a translator
In the warm of a dilemma, strange line products accumulate. Attempt to separate labor, materials, and devices. A fair estimate for a burst line in a wall will certainly reveal time to open and shut the wall, time to fix the line, and product costs. If there is drywall or floor tile work, you ought to see whether that is consisted of or described one more trade. On drain blockages, some firms use a flat price for cord cleaning and a different cost for camera evaluation and finding. Jetting typically has a hourly minimum due to setup time.
Watch for obscure expressions that leave space for disagreements later on. Better language looks like this, "Change 15 feet of 3 quarter inch copper from water heater to manifold, consisting of two sphere shutoffs and insulation, stress test to 80 psi." Much less practical language looks like, "Repair pipeline in garage." Specifics protect both sides.

How pros come close to pipes troubleshooting in Ft Worth
Speed does not mean presuming. It suggests applying a sequence. On a thought slab leakage, for example, I isolate the cold and hot systems and examine them separately. Most piece leaks here occur on hot lines as a result of growth and deterioration at call factors with rebar or rough concrete. If stress holds on the cool however not the hot, I then use digital boosting to quest the leak course, sometimes combined with thermal imaging. Breaking concrete comes last, not first.
For sewage system backups, I begin with a cable television to open circulation and after that run a camera to recognize why it clogged. In our clay soils, root intrusion at clay to PVC transitions is common for older lines, while stubborn belly sagging that traps solids shows up in newer tracts with improperly compressed trenches. Jetting clears grease and soft origins better than a cable. If I see a duplicated problem area, I note it from the surface. By doing this, if a repair work is required, your landscape team is not guessing where to dig.
With water heaters, code compliance matters as high as feature. T&P safety valve should discharge to a safe place and not uphill. Pan drains have to actually drain pipes. In garages, elevation and seismic strapping may use depending on the installment. Gas connections require debris catches. I have actually seen heating units changed fast in emergency situations, just to find venting that backdrafts carbon monoxide into an attic room. A certified plumber in Fort Well worth understands regional assessors and will not cut that corner.
Gas leaks are absolutely no concession. If a gas line fails a fixed examination, I separate sections, soap examination fittings, and change questionable sections as opposed to stacking string sealer till it appears great. Energy firms handle the meter side. On the house side, do not allow anyone relight devices without verifying draft and clearances.
Two quick situation researches that mirror usual calls
A household in Tanglewood woke to a soaked living-room carpet, but no noticeable leakage. The water was warm, and the pressure seemed weak. We shut the warm water shutoff at the heater and the merging stopped. That pointed straight to a warm side slab leakage. Pressure reading verified a decrease only on the warm. We used acoustic listening and discovered the loudest point near a cooking area peninsula. Rather than jackhammer floor tile in the center of the space, we re-routed the warm line overhead via the attic room and down a chase, shielded it, and left the piece pipe deserted. 5 hours on website, exact same day. The house owner prevented a dust storm and a ceramic tile nightmare.
At a coffee shop off Magnolia, the washrooms backed up twice in one month. The owner had actually paid for snaking both times. This time around we cabled to open up flow, then ran a cam. Oil from the cooking area was finishing the line before it reached the city faucet. The building lacked an appropriately sized grease interceptor. We jetted the line to restore complete diameter and revealed the owner the video. They mounted an appropriately sized interceptor and put a basic filter enter nighttime closing. No backups for a year and counting.
